Jason Gardiner’s had a rough time on this year’s Dancing On Ice. Some reckon he brought trouble on himself with his catty comments, while some of you think that DOI views have been quick to complain about nothing.
Well at last someone’s said something nice about Jason. His fellow Dancing On Ice judges Emma Bunton and Robin Cousins have stuck up for the hat-loving dancer during a chat with Phil and Holly on This Morning.
When asked what they think if Jason’s acerbic comments, Robin actually admitted he wished he could be just as honest, "Sometimes I think 'gosh I wish I had said that' or had the nerve to say it! I've always said I love the fact that he has an opinion and he’s able to justify it and say it - I wish I could have the nerve to say similar, probably not the same thing! But to have the nerve to be that blunt."
While Emma revealed that not only does she often find Jason’s remarks quite funny, but the skaters take his critiques most seriously; “Sometimes I'm trying not laugh. He does make me laugh...but I don't laugh at all of them. They [the skaters] really want to hear what Jason has got to say... and although they might not like it at the time they really think about it and go away and work on those things. I have known Jason for years, and he does say to me 'you're not wearing that are you?' he's very, very honest and some people take it with a pinch of salt and some take it very seriously."
